Plug Power (PLUG) is actively enhancing its liquidity to support the ongoing growth of its hydrogen energy initiatives amidst organizational changes. Recently, the company has taken a significant step by selling a federal investment tax credit (ITC) valued at approximately $39.2 million linked to its St. Gabriel hydrogen liquefaction facility. This strategic maneuver is designed to bolster Plug Power's financial resources, enabling the company to continue advancing its capabilities in the hydrogen sector. Such liquidity improvements are critical as the market for hydrogen energy expands, and they reflect the company's proactive approach to meeting its financial obligations and pursuing new growth opportunities.

Navigating Challenges
However, as Plug Power navigates these financial strategies, it faces challenges, particularly with ongoing insider stock sales which could affect investor confidence. The resignation of Director Kavita Mahtani, a key figure in the company's governance, adds another layer of complexity to the management dynamics during this pivotal phase. Commitment to Clean Energy
In parallel with these developments, the company's previous ITC transfer, worth $30 million for a project in Woodbine, Georgia, underscores Plug Power's continued effort to leverage federal financial incentives to foster growth.
